Your koi may be getting fat due to overfeeding, as they can easily consume more food than necessary, especially in warmer weather when their metabolism increases. Additionally, a lack of exercise, such as limited swimming space or stagnant water, can contribute to weight gain. Poor water quality or an imbalanced diet lacking essential nutrients can also lead to obesity in koi. It's essential to monitor their feeding habits and ensure a balanced diet to maintain their health.
